The History of St Patrick's Day

St. Patrick's Day is a cultural and religious celebration held on March 17th, marking the death date of St. Patrick, the patron saint of Ireland. Despite its Irish roots, the day is celebrated worldwide, especially in countries with large Irish communities.

St. Patrick's Day commemorates the arrival of Christianity in Ireland and celebrates Irish culture and heritage. According to legend, St. Patrick used the three-leaf shamrock to explain the Holy Trinity to the Irish, which is why the shamrock is now a symbol of the day.

Originally a religious feast day, it has evolved into a variety of festivals across the globe featuring parades, special foods, music, dancing, and a whole lot of green.

Popular Green Flowers to use in St Patrick's Day Bouquets

Green flowers bring a unique and refreshing touch to any floral arrangement or garden, embodying the essence of growth, renewal, and the natural world. Often associated with harmony, balance, and tranquility, these verdant blooms can range from subtle, pale shades to vibrant, eye-catching hues. They serve as wonderful complements to more traditional flower colours, adding depth, variety, and a sense of whimsy.

Perfect for creating themed arrangements for events like St. Patrick's Day, adding a modern twist to weddings, or simply celebrating the beauty of nature, green flowers have a special place in the world of floristry. Here's a list of some of the most enchanting green flowers you might consider:

Green Chrysanthemums

Green Chrysanthemums are a symbol of rejuvenation and longevity. Their vibrant green petals can add a refreshing pop of colour to any bouquet or garden, making them a favorite for celebrations and decorative arrangements.

Green Viburnum

The Green Viburnum, also called 'Guelder Rose', often recognised for its snowball-like clusters of lime green flowers, is a striking addition to any garden. Its vibrant green blooms transition to white, offering a visual spectacle and attracting various pollinators.

Green Carnations

Once a symbol of secret love, Green Carnations today are often associated with St. Patrick's Day celebrations. Their bright green hue stands out in arrangements, making them a playful choice for festive bouquets.

Green Bells of Ireland

Known for their tall, striking spikes covered with bell-shaped green flowers, Green Bells of Ireland symbolise good luck. They add an interesting vertical element to arrangements and are often used in traditional Irish weddings. This flower looks extra elegant on their own in a tall vase. Its interesting shape makes for an interesting vase display.

Green Calla Lilies

With their sleek, trumpet-shaped blooms and vibrant green hue, Green Calla Lilies exude elegance and sophistication. They are a popular choice for modern wedding bouquets and minimalist arrangements such as ikebana.

Decorate a St. Patrick's Day Wreath

Decorate your home for St. Patrick's Day with a beautifully crafted wreath, a wonderful idea to showcase your festive spirit right at your doorstep.

A wreath isn't just a decoration; it's a warm welcome to guests, symbolising the endless cycle of life and the renewal spring brings, perfectly echoing the essence of St. Patrick's Day.

Consider creating your wreath from natural elements like fresh or faux greenery, embodying the lush landscapes of Ireland. Integrate traditional flowers such as Bells of Ireland, green carnations, and shamrock accents to honor the day's significance.

Not only do these elements bring texture and colour, but they also infuse your space with the symbolism of luck and prosperity. Crafting a wreath allows you to express your personal style while engaging in a creative endeavor that celebrates Irish culture and the joy of the season.

 

Greenery and Flower Combinations

Transform your space into a vibrant haven of St. Patrick's Day festivities by incorporating an abundance of greenery and pairing it with delightful green flowers.

The versatility of various greens, such as eucalyptus, ferns, and ivy, offers a lush and refreshing foundation for your decorations. Complement this verdant backdrop with the vibrant shades of green flowers like guelder rose, Bells of Ireland, or green carnations.

The result is a harmonious fusion of textures and hues that captures the essence of the holiday and infuses your surroundings with the lively spirit of St. Patrick's Day.
